Maps.gov.ge is the official web-based Geographic Information System (GIS) portal of Georgia, managed by the National Agency of Public Registry under the Ministry of Justice. While commercial giants like Google Maps or Yandex dominate consumer navigation, maps gov ge serves a different, more critical purpose: Legal cadaster, land ownership records, zoning regulations, and topographic surveys. maps gov ge
The platform is the digital face of the Georgian national infrastructure for spatial data. It aggregates data from various state agencies into a single, interactive map viewer. If you need to know who owns a specific plot of land in Kakheti, the elevation of a mountain in Svaneti, or the administrative boundaries of a neighborhood in Tbilisi, this is the authoritative source. Before the launch of the modern maps.gov.ge , Georgia faced a fragmented spatial data landscape. Following the collapse of the Soviet Union, land records were often paper-based, outdated, or lost. Solution: By law, the interactive map does not display full names of private individuals for privacy reasons.
